I also have no experiences to share, but I can fill you in with a few
details of what Oracle says:

10gR2 is supported on AIX 6.1 Service Pack 1 or higher.
You need to run the 64 bit kernel.
10gR2 with HACMP is not yet certified.

You should run a specific rootpre.sh that you can download from Metalink
to avoid bug 6613550.

Read Metalink note 282036.1 which contains all the details.
